Pulitzer Prize-winning poet Jericho Brown shares his journey through identity, healing, and the creative process. He emphasizes the importance of self-acceptance, revealing how vulnerability fuels artistic expression. Jericho discusses overcoming trauma through laughter and the significance of community support. The conversation also highlights the interplay of pain and joy in poetry, challenging societal norms around emotional openness. With humor and wisdom, he inspires listeners to embrace their identities and the healing power of creativity.

ANECDOTE

Reinventing Yourself

  • Jericho Brown left a stable job to pursue poetry, leading to a reinvention of himself.
  • He changed his name after a dream, symbolizing his transformation and commitment to his art.
